Senior Recreation Leader, Camp Jackson This is a seasonal position from June 1st - August 21st. Please apply before May 1, 2026 to be considered. Essential duties and responsibilities may include, but are not limited to, the following: Supervises and leads the day-to-day operations of assigned recreation programs and activities; assembles necessary supplies for each activity. May take attendance for assigned group and records names of participants who are not in attendance; calls participants or parents to verify absences as necessary. Oversees, leads, and assists with various activities; observes participants during program; enforces rules and safety procedures; implements disciplinary actions as necessary. Participates in facility or venue set-up, clean-up, and sanitation. Supports the relationship between the Teton County staff and the general public by demonstrating courteous and cooperative behavior when interacting with visitors and County staff; maintains confidentiality of work-related issues and County information; performs other duties as required or assigned. The Senior Recreation Leader will specifically: Provide direct supervision, interacts, and engages with all children during the program. Assist/participate in: administering behavior protocol as directed, administering all medical protocol as directed, verbal and physical assistance, and accomplishes all other tasks as directed. Create a nurturing, positive and professional environment while promoting program policies and procedures amongst staff and campers. Maintaining constant supervision of campers, enforcing all safety regulations, and following emergency procedures. Participate actively and enthusiastically in all camp activities, staff meetings and training sessions. Planning, leading, and implementing age-appropriate, engaging, and safe activities, such as arts and crafts, sports, or nature hikes. If over 21: driver's license is required with the ability to transport campers in a 15-passenger van Comfortable working outdoors and supervising children in or around a pool like setting or large bodies of water & swimming. M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: Education and Experience: High school diploma or GED equivalent 1-3 years of experience in recreation programs or working with children Required Licenses and Certifications: Must possess or have ability to obtain a valid Wyoming/Idaho Driver's License and maintain an acceptable driving record. CPR and First Aid Certification or the ability to obtain certification. Required Knowledge of: Recreation site safety rules and regulations. Methods of program planning and implementation. Principles, practices, and methods of conflict resolution and problem solving. Required Skills in: Establishing and maintaining cooperative working relationships with coworkers and other individuals in contact during the course of work; communicating clearly and concisely Assessing, prioritizing, and completing multiple tasks and demands simultaneously. Administering basic first aid. If assigned to Youth Enrichment: Ability to transport campers in a 15-passenger vehicle. Comfortable working outdoors and supervising children in or around a pool like setting or large bodies of water. Physical Demands/Work Environment: Work is performed both in an indoor or protected environment and outdoors. The incumbent may be occasionally exposed to unfavorable conditions while located at County facilities or at other locations during the course of business. Required to work routine nights and weekends as regular schedule. Required to work unsupervised in the presence of children or vulnerable adults.
